FAQ
Q: What is Wukong?
A: Wukong is an AI-powered agent work platform that can operate your computer like a real assistant and help you complete tasks ranging from simple to complex. Wukong is not a chatbot. It is an AI desktop agent that can actually get work done. See About Wukong for details.
Q: Where can I access Wukong?
1. Local computer client (recommended for the full experience)
Best for: daily work, deep control over local files and apps, and long-term stable use.
How to get it: Download now from the official website
- System requirements:
- Windows 10 64-bit version 1909 or later (beta)
- macOS 14 or later (Apple Silicon, beta; Intel support coming soon)
- Key benefits:
- Direct control of local software such as Excel, browsers, and IDEs
- Local-first data processing for stronger privacy
- Best performance by using local computing resources
2. Wukong Cloud PC
Best for: users without a suitable local machine, quick trials, temporary tasks, and scenarios requiring strong isolation.
How to get it: Purchase a Wukong Cloud PC when enabling Wukong.
- Key benefits:
- Ready in minutes, without local environment setup
- Tasks run in an isolated cloud sandbox
- Remote access from tablets, phones, and other lighter devices
3. DingTalk integration (mobile and desktop management)
Best for: starting tasks anytime, checking progress in real time, and mobile work.
- Key benefits:
- Available on phones, tablets, and DingTalk desktop
- Instant DingTalk notifications when tasks finish, fail, or need confirmation
- Entry points:
- IM bot: find Wukong in your DingTalk chat list and start tasks through conversation
- Left workbench in the client: click the Wukong app icon in DingTalk to enter the visual management panel

Q: How is Wukong priced?
A: All users, including unpaid users, receive 100 compute credits per day. Credits reset the next day, with a monthly cap of 500 free credits. Once those are used up, you need a Wukong membership to continue using the service. Standard membership is RMB 39/month, and Advanced membership is RMB 99/month.

- If you need more credits, you can buy additional top-up packs. Domestic top-up packs are valid for one year, and consumption order is: free credits → membership credits → top-up pack credits.
| Pack | Credits | Price |
|---|---|---|
| Small | 200 | ¥9.8 |
| Large | 2,000 | ¥98 |

Q: Will using Wukong cause enterprise data leakage?
A: No. Wukong operates only within the permissions the user already has and on the user’s own device. Without user consent, DingTalk will not use Wukong-related data for other purposes or for AI model training.
Q: How can I submit feedback or report issues?
A: Open Wukong, then go to avatar in the bottom-left → General Settings → Help and Feedback to submit support requests or product suggestions.

Q: How should data be handled before leaving a company?
A: Because the user is the controller of the Wukong app on their device, they can reset the app before leaving. If administrators are concerned about access, they should reclaim data permissions and related access before offboarding according to company policy.
To clear usage history and cache, use the reset action: Wukong → avatar in the bottom-left → About → Reset App.
Note: data cannot be recovered after reset, so proceed carefully.

Q: How do I add Wukong skills?
A: In the Wukong Skills Center, you can add skills in three ways:
- Upload your own: if you already have a skill package, click Upload Skill to import it.

- Choose recommended skills: browse the Recommended Skills list and add suitable popular skills with one click.

- Create quickly: click Add New Skill to open the skill creation assistant. Enter the capability you want and the assistant will generate and configure a new skill.

Q: Does the DingTalk Professional edition cover all members?
A: Yes. In DingTalk Professional and Exclusive Edition organizations, all members can receive the basic daily AI compute-credit benefit, which follows the same standard as free users.
Q: Does the Professional edition include extra benefits?
A: Yes. You automatically receive the benefits of Wukong Standard Membership, which would normally cost RMB 39/month. However, this benefit covers the membership features only and does not include the original package’s 1,000-credit bundle. Your regular AI usage still uses the daily base quota granted to all members of Professional and Exclusive Edition organizations: 100 compute credits per person per day.
